Understanding the MAX56X Family of Chips

The MAX56X chip series represents a flexible set of audio drivers from Maxim Microelectronics, engineered for a extensive variety of applications. These small components are particularly known for their superb fidelity and low current draw. Key attributes include adjustable gain, built-in safeguards against short circuits, and a flexible operating voltage. They are commonly employed in portable players, such as earphones, smartphones, and multiple gadgets.
